#e66022 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e66022 is composed of 90.2% red, 37.6% green and 13.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 58.3% magenta, 85.2% yellow and 9.8% black. It has a hue angle of 19 degrees, a saturation of 79.7% and a lightness of 51.8%. #e66022 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ffc044 with #cd0000. Closest websafe color is: #ff6633.

● #e66022 color description : Vivid orange.
#e66022 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e66022 has RGB values of R:230, G:96, B:34 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.58, Y:0.85,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 15097890.

Shades and Tints of #e66022
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#080301 is the darkest color, while #fef8f5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e66022
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#878381 is the less saturated color, while #f9590f is the most saturated one.
